Transaction ebcd540626a9df3ac9d29cf12ec697582c8d91eece39d36ee17a6e5fb94a3f9a
1 Input
1 Output
-
ebcd540626a9df3ac9d29cf12ec697582c8d91eece39d36ee17a6e5fb94a3f9a:0
- value
- 13530857
- script pubkey
- OP_0 OP_PUSHBYTES_20 8832962326ab5cdf12a67ea55df8b67c24653ae8
- address
- bc1q3qefvgex4dwd7y4x06j4m79k0sjx2whg64w5s9